A function is a mathematical expression, rule, or law that specifies the relationship between one variable (the dependent variable) and another variable (the independent variable).
Function given in the question = (x + 1)^(1/3) - 2
Initial function for this is f(x) = x^(1/3)
The changes done in the question is f(x + 1) - 2
Hence the graph of x^(1/3) will go one unit to the left on the X-axis and two units down on the Y-axis.
